I was actually kinda excited about watching TMNT the movie, anticipating the relive of my childhood with our four all-familiar turtles Leonardo, Raphael, Michelangelo and Donatello. But perhaps my expectations was too high due to the hype among my friends about the movie, I did not quite enjoy the movie. I felt that it did not do justice to our four heroes with the short screening duration (90minutes). Also, it was more of a 'touch and go' for Michelangelo and Donatello as they came out only in the final fighting scene, whereas Leonardo and Raphael had a few more fighting scenes and sometimes with Casey. The humour from Michelangelo was just right to spice up the movie at times when it was just about the 'conflict' between Leonardo and Raphael wanting to be the leader. Their story could have been further developed instead of merely ending at the point when Leonardo was caught and Raphael returning to his rat sensei for 'forgiveness'. The fighting scene between the super-ninja fighting team and the ancient monsters was too short, in my opinion. It wasn't long enough to make me go 'wow' but instead, it left me wanting more. Actually, the voiceovers for the characters were also one of the main factors that pulled me into the cinema to watch TMNT, especially when I heard that Zhang Ziyi was one of the voices. However, the amount of time and also the number of words she spoke were rather minimal (My ears might be playing tricks on me cos I thought I heard her say 'stop' in Chinese ? at one pt of time), but credit should still be given to her and also the makers of the movie for all the voiceovers such as Chris Evans (Casey) and Sarah Michelle Gellar (April).
